集成系统信息管理工程师如何高效协调多系统数据流与业务流程?
在当今数字化转型加速的时代,企业内部的IT架构日益复杂,各类业务系统如ERP、CRM、MES、HRM等层出不穷,彼此之间存在大量数据交互需求。此时,集成系统信息管理工程师(Integrated Systems Information Management Engineer)的角色变得尤为关键——他们不仅是技术桥梁,更是业务价值实现的关键推动者。
一、什么是集成系统信息管理工程师?
集成系统信息管理工程师是专注于设计、实施和维护跨平台信息系统集成解决方案的专业技术人员。他们的核心职责包括:梳理组织内多个系统的数据结构与接口规范,构建统一的数据交换机制,确保不同系统间的信息同步、一致性与安全性,同时支持业务流程自动化与可视化监控。
该岗位通常需要掌握多种技术栈,如API开发(RESTful / SOAP)、中间件(如Apache Kafka、MuleSoft)、ETL工具(Informatica、Talend)、微服务架构(Spring Boot、Docker)、以及数据库管理(MySQL、PostgreSQL、MongoDB)等。更重要的是,他们还需具备良好的业务理解能力,能够将复杂的业务逻辑转化为可执行的技术方案。
二、集成系统信息管理工程师的核心工作内容
1. 系统现状评估与需求分析
第一步是对现有系统的全面盘点,包括但不限于:
- 识别各系统之间的依赖关系与数据流向
- 梳理业务流程中的关键节点与瓶颈
- 收集各部门对数据共享、流程协同的具体诉求
例如,在制造企业中,若生产管理系统(MES)无法实时获取原材料库存信息(来自ERP),会导致排产计划滞后甚至停线。集成工程师需定位问题根源并提出整合方案。
2. 设计集成架构与接口标准
基于需求分析结果,工程师会设计一套合理的集成架构,常见模式有:
- 点对点集成(Point-to-Point):适用于少量系统间的简单对接,但扩展性差
- 中心化集成(Hub-and-Spoke):通过一个中央消息总线(如ESB)连接所有系统,适合中型企业
- 事件驱动架构(Event-Driven Architecture, EDA):利用消息队列(如Kafka)实现实时异步通信,适合高并发场景
同时制定统一的数据格式规范(JSON Schema或XML Schema),定义API调用权限、认证方式(OAuth2.0 / JWT)及错误处理机制。
3. 开发与部署集成组件
工程师使用编程语言(Java、Python、Node.js)编写适配器、转换器和服务模块,例如:
- 将ERP中的订单数据自动同步至WMS仓库系统
- 从CRM客户数据中提取标签字段,供营销自动化平台使用
- 通过Webhook机制触发第三方支付网关回调通知
这些组件通常封装为微服务部署在容器化环境中(如Kubernetes),便于运维与弹性伸缩。
4. 监控、日志与异常处理
集成系统一旦上线,持续运行稳定性至关重要。工程师需搭建完善的监控体系:
- 使用Prometheus + Grafana监控API响应时间、调用量、错误率
- 配置ELK(Elasticsearch + Logstash + Kibana)集中采集日志,快速定位问题
- 设置告警规则(如5分钟内失败次数超过阈值则邮件通知)
此外,建立容错机制(如重试策略、死信队列)防止因个别系统故障导致整体中断。
5. 持续优化与迭代升级
随着业务发展,原有集成方案可能不再适用。工程师需定期评估性能瓶颈、安全风险,并进行重构或升级:
- 将单体式API拆分为更细粒度的服务
- 引入缓存层(Redis)提升高频查询效率
- 采用零信任架构加强跨系统访问控制
这一过程强调敏捷思维与DevOps实践,确保集成系统始终贴合业务演进节奏。
三、典型应用场景案例解析
案例1:电商企业的订单履约一体化集成
某电商平台面临的问题是:用户下单后,订单信息需依次传递给仓储系统(WMS)、物流系统(TMS)、财务系统(ERP)和客服系统(CRM)。传统做法由人工手动录入,效率低且易出错。
解决方案:
- 设计基于Kafka的消息驱动架构,订单状态变更自动广播到下游系统
- 开发标准化订单数据模型,统一字段命名与单位标准(如金额单位为人民币元)
- 实现异常补偿机制:若某个环节失败,自动回滚并记录详细日志供人工介入
效果:订单平均处理时间从4小时缩短至15分钟,错误率下降90%。
案例2:医疗行业的电子病历互通集成
多家医院希望实现患者跨院就诊记录共享,但各院HIS系统差异巨大,难以直接对接。
解决方案:
- 采用FHIR(Fast Healthcare Interoperability Resources)标准构建通用数据模型
- 开发中间件适配器,将本地HIS数据映射为FHIR资源格式
- 通过API网关统一暴露接口,满足合规审计要求(GDPR / HIPAA)
效果:医生可实时查看历史诊疗数据,提高诊断准确性;患者无需重复提供基础资料。
四、技能要求与发展路径
必备硬技能
- 熟悉主流集成框架(MuleSoft、IBM App Connect、Apache Camel)
- 精通至少一种编程语言(Java首选,Python用于脚本开发)
- 掌握云原生技术(AWS/Azure/GCP上的集成服务如EventBridge、Logic Apps)
- 了解数据治理原则(元数据管理、主数据管理MDM)
软技能同样重要
- 跨部门沟通协调能力:能与业务部门、IT团队、供应商有效协作
- 文档撰写能力:输出清晰的API文档、集成手册、操作指南
- 问题排查能力:快速定位“黑盒”问题,比如数据延迟或格式不匹配
职业发展路径
从初级集成工程师起步,逐步成长为:
- 中级:负责模块级集成设计与实施
- 高级:主导全链路集成架构规划与项目管理
- 专家级:成为首席架构师或解决方案顾问,参与行业标准制定
部分从业者还会向DevOps工程师、数据科学家或产品经理方向延伸,形成复合型人才优势。
五、未来趋势:AI赋能下的智能集成
随着人工智能技术的发展,集成系统信息管理正迈向智能化:
- 利用NLP自动解析非结构化文档(如合同、发票),提取关键字段注入系统
- 通过机器学习预测接口性能波动,提前扩容资源
- 引入RPA机器人自动完成跨系统手工操作(如审批流转)
未来,集成工程师将不仅仅是“搭桥人”,更是“智慧中枢”的设计者,助力企业真正实现数据驱动决策。
结语
集成系统信息管理工程师是数字时代不可或缺的战略角色。他们不仅解决技术层面的孤岛问题,更推动组织内部协作效率与创新能力的全面提升。面对不断增长的系统复杂度与业务多样性,唯有持续学习、深入业务、拥抱新技术,才能在这个岗位上脱颖而出,为企业创造真实价值。

